> +static void dcc_shutdown(struct uart_port *port)
> +{
> +#ifdef DCC_IRQ_USED /* real IRQ used */
> + free_irq(port->irq, port);
> +#else
> + spin_lock(&port->lock);
> + cancel_rearming_delayed_work(&dcc_poll_task);
cancel_rearming_delayed_work() might sleep due to it calling
flush_workqueue. Therefore, you must not be holding a spinlock.
